Dark Match:
Daniel Bryan (c) def. Ted DiBiase to RETAIN the WWE US Championship
-Bryan forced DiBiase to submit to the LeBelle Lock

Dolph Ziggler (c) def. Jack Swagger and Kofi Kingston in a ladder match to RETAIN the Intercontinental Championship
-Kofi unhooked the belt but it fell to the mat and Ziggler grabbed it.

Beth Phoenix & Natalya def. Layla & Michelle McCool in a tables match
-Natalya splashed both Michelle and Layla through the table

Santino Marella & Vladimir Kozlov (c) def. Justin Gabriel & Heath Slater by disqualification to RETAIN the WWE Tag Team Championship
-Michael McGillicutty was seen interfering as Santino was trying for The Cobra

John Morrison def. Sheamus in a ladder match to become the next no. 1 contender for the WWE Championship
-Morrison kicked Sheamus off the ladder, then climbed and grabbed the contract.

The Miz (c) def. Randy Orton in a tables match to RETAIN the WWE Championship
-Miz pushed Alex Riley into Orton, sending Orton off the ring apron and into a table

Edge def. Kane (c), Alberto Del Rio and Rey Mysterio in a TLC Match to WIN the WWE World Heavyweight Championship
-Edge speared Kane off the apron and into a table before climbing the ladder to retrieve the belt

John Cena def. Wade Barrett in a chairs match
-Cena pinned Barrett after an Attitude Adjustment onto some chairs
